BELL, Judge.

1. The first special ground of the amended motion for new trial contends that the following material evidence was illegally admitted by the court to the jury over the objection of the plaintiff at the time it was offered, on the grounds that it was hearsay and not admissible: "There was a lady come down there and she said she was a doctor and she looked at Mr. Camp and says, `He is just shook up.'
